Venezuela national rugby union team
The Venezuelan rugby union team represents Venezuela in the Rugby Union. The team is classified as a national of the third category by the International Rugby Board (IRB ).
History
Only in 1998 joined the Venezuelan Association of the International Rugby Board. The first international match they lost narrowly to the selection of Trinidad and Tobago with 26:23.
Despite two participations in the qualification for the Rugby Union World Cup in 2003 and 2007 so far failed to qualify for the final tournament to be. The team failed each in the first qualifying round of Brazil.
